The Enigmatic Rise of the Global Gaming Empire: Exploring the Cultural and Economic Impact of Video Game Revenue Streams
In recent years, the video game industry has experienced a seismic shift, transforming from a niche entertainment sector to a global gaming empire. The unprecedented success of popular titles and the emergence of new revenue streams have catapulted the industry into the spotlight, captivating the attention of investors, developers, and gamers alike.
The global gaming market is projected to reach $190 billion by 2025, with revenue streams diversifying beyond traditional gaming platforms. Subscription-based services, in-game advertising, and e-sports have become increasingly popular, attracting new audiences and transforming the gaming landscape.
The Rise of the Gaming Empire: Understanding the Mechanics
So, what drives the growth of the gaming empire? The key lies in a combination of factors, including:
- A growing global player base, driven by increasing smartphone penetration and the rise of cloud gaming.
- The evolution of gaming platforms, with the emergence of PC, console, and mobile-first titles.
- The development of new business models, including subscription-based services and in-game advertising.

The Future of Gaming: Opportunities and Challenges
As the gaming empire continues to expand, new opportunities emerge for gamers, developers, and investors alike. However, challenges also arise, including:
- The need for greater diversity and representation in games.
- The risk of addiction and mental health concerns associated with gaming.
- The ongoing debate surrounding game loot boxes and in-game purchases.
